Development of a Multiple-Choice Test for Novice Anesthesia Residents to Evaluate Knowledge Related to Management of General Anesthesia for Urgent Cesarean Delivery.

Background: Teaching trainees the knowledge and skills to perform general anesthesia (GA) for cesarean delivery (CD) requires innovative strategies, as they may never manage such cases in training. We used a multistage design process to create a criterion-referenced multiple-choice test as an assessment tool to evaluate CA1's knowledge related to this scenario.

Methods: Three faculty created 33 questions, categorized as: (1) physiologic changes of pregnancy (PCP), (2) pharmacology (PHA), (3) anesthetic implications of pregnancy (AIP), and (4) crisis resource management principles (CRM). A Delphi process (3 rounds) provided content validation. In round 1, experts (n = 15) ranked questions on a 7-point Likert scale. Questions ranked ≥ 5 in importance by ≥ 70% of experts were retained. Five questions were eliminated, several were revised, and 1 added. In round 2, consensus (N = 14) was reached in all except 7 questions. In round 3 (N = 14), all questions stabilized. A pilot test of the 29-question instrument evaluating internal consistency, reliability, convergent validity, and item analysis was conducted with the July CA1 classes at our institution after a lecture on GA for CD (n = 26, "instructed group") and another institution with no lecture (n = 26, "uninstructed group"), CA2s (N = 17), and attendings (N = 10).

Results: Acceptable internal consistency and reliability was demonstrated (ρ = 0.67). Convergent validity coefficients between the CA1 uninstructed and instructed group suggested theoretical meaningfulness of the 4 sub-scales: PCP correlated at 0.29 with PHA, 0.35 with CRM, and 0.25 with AIP. PHA correlated with CRM and AIP at 0.23 and 0.28, respectively. The correlation between CRM and AIP was 0.29.

Conclusion: The test produces moderately reliable scores to assess CA1s' knowledge related to GA for urgent CD.
